Return-Path: Delivered-To: apmail-apr-dev-archive@www.apache.org Received: (qmail 14399 invoked from network); 31 Mar 2005 07:23:28 -0000 Received: from hermes.apache.org (HELO mail.apache.org) (209.237.227.199) by minotaur.apache.org with SMTP; 31 Mar 2005 07:23:28 -0000 Received: (qmail 40316 invoked by uid 500); 31 Mar 2005 07:23:27 -0000 Delivered-To: apmail-apr-dev-archive@apr.apache.org Received: (qmail 40019 invoked by uid 500); 31 Mar 2005 07:23:26 -0000 Mailing-List: contact dev-help@apr.apache.org; run by ezmlm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: Delivered-To: mailing list dev@apr.apache.org Received: (qmail 39999 invoked by uid 99); 31 Mar 2005 07:23:26 -0000 X-ASF-Spam-Status: No, hits=0.1 required=10.0 tests=FORGED_RCVD_HELO X-Spam-Check-By: apache.org Received-SPF: pass (hermes.apache.org: local policy) Received: from valiant.concentric.net (HELO valiant.cnchost.com) (207.155.252.9) by apache.org (qpsmtpd/0.28) with ESMTP; Wed, 30 Mar 2005 23:23:25 -0800 Received: from rcsv650.rowe-clan.net (c-24-13-128-132.client.comcast.net [24.13.128.132]) by valiant.cnchost.com id CAA24429; Thu, 31 Mar 2005 02:23:23 -0500 (EST) [ConcentricHost SMTP Relay 1.17] Errors-To: Message-Id: <6.2.1.2.2.20050331011438.064939c0@pop3.rowe-clan.net> X-Mailer: QUALCOMM Windows Eudora Version 6.2.1.2 Date: Thu, 31 Mar 2005 01:16:31 -0600 To: Mladen Turk From: "William A. Rowe, Jr." Subject: Re: apr-iconv 1.0 Cc: Curt Arnold , APR Developer List In-Reply-To: <424B9755.10007@apache.org> References: <6.1.0.6.2.20040623142928.07b85ec0@pop3.rowe-clan.net> <40E4A125.2000206@xbc.nu> <6.1.0.6.2.20040702022101.0413ee38@pop3.rowe-clan.net> <40E59F80.8020000@xbc.nu> <6.2.1.2.2.20050329164227.02df2eb0@pop3.rowe-clan.net> <424AD10E.1020905@apache.org> <6.2.1.2.2.20050330121850.067c4340@pop3.rowe-clan.net> <9d0a8bf22175edaf72d06d1b6e36eca3@houston.rr.com> <6.2.1.2.2.20050330143751.05a8c380@pop3.rowe-clan.net> <3b0b3bc69aebf7891a842ed62b57b63f@apache.org> <6.2.1.2.2.20050330160721.062a3be0@pop3.rowe-clan.net> <424B9755.10007@apache.org>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ii" X-Virus-Checked: Checked X-Spam-Rating: minotaur.apache.org 1.6.2 0/1000/N At 12:23 AM 3/31/2005, Mladen Turk wrote: >William A. Rowe, Jr. wrote: >>FWIW - who else in this community wants to participate if such >>an ASL/BSD licensed iconv project grew up around the most current >>code for iconv? > >Well, I'm interested if the final product will not depend on a >hundred or so separate .dll's for each and every charset, and >if apr_util will not depend on apr_iconv. I'd see that as advantage as well. I understand loadable modules for complex translations, but not for tables. >Also I think we should consider using >MultiByteToWideChar/WideCharToMultiByte on windows as >an option to apr_xlate if iconv is not present. See my post on this very point. The API does not lend itself whatsoever to streaming data. Most every APR application is dealing with streamed text so this isn't really a useful option.